Who builds Husqvarna riding mowers?

Husqvarna lawn mowers are manufactured in the United States at Husqvarna Consumer Outdoor Products NA, Inc factories in Orangeburg, South Carolina and McRae, Georgia

Where is John Deere made?

John Deere has kept its roots in the United States The world headquarters is in Moline, Illinois, USA The company continues to make tractors of various different types at factories in four US states: Georgia, Tennessee, Iowa and Wisconsin The business has been an international one since 1912

What is the most durable riding mower?

In Consumer Reports’ 2017 survey of 11,217 subscribers, John Deere takes the top prize as the most reliable brand of lawn tractors and among the more reliable zero-turn-radius mowers

Are John Deere riding mowers made in the USA?

John Deere Today, they maintain manufacturing facilities in 7 countries (including 3 in China), which raises eyebrows among those who suspect their mowers may be made overseas However, I’m happy to report all John Deere riding mowers are manufactured in Horicon, Wisconsin USA from parts made mostly in the USA

What brand engine does John Deere use?

The engines used in their machinery are mainly made by themselves but for certain machinery which requires less horsepower like 100Hp and below, John Deere uses engines from Kawasaki, Yanmar, and Briggs & Stratton
